What is a good way to conduct an interview?

The STAR interview method is a structured approach to answering behavioral interview questions in a way that clearly outlines your experiences and achievements. STAR stands for Situation, Task, Action, and Result, and it provides a framework to help you organize your thoughts and present your responses in a coherent and compelling manner. This technique is widely used by top employers like Google, JP Morgan Chase, Deloitte, and Nestle due to its effectiveness in predicting future job performance.
